Mechanical Design Manager – Industrial Automation
Job Summary
The Mechanical Design Manager is responsible for leading the mechanical design and development activities for industrial automation projects. The role involves managing the design team, overseeing machine and automation system design, ensuring technical accuracy, coordinating with cross-functional departments, and supporting project execution from concept to commissioning.

Required Skills & Competencies
- Strong knowledge of industrial automation systems and machine design.
- Expertise in CAD software such as SolidWorks, AutoCAD, Creo, or Inventor.
- Good understanding of pneumatics, hydraulics, servo systems, conveyors, and robotics integration.
- Knowledge of fabrication processes, machining, and assembly practices.
- Strong leadership, project management, and problem-solving skills.
- Ability to handle multiple projects simultaneously.
- Excellent communication and team coordination abilities.
